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 20268

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 20268?

Actualmente hay 975 Apartamentos Estudios en 20268 con alquileres que van desde $719 hasta $14,017, con un precio medio de $2,244.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 20268?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 20268 varian entre $868 y $17,542 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,876

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 20268?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 20268 van desde $941 hasta $23,247.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$4,198

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 20268?

En estos momentos hay 224 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 20268 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,092 y $21,270 - con una media de $5,777 para el lugar.
